Cinderella -- Cinderella

At this point in time Дисней had established itself as a beloved children's Анимация studio, however the studio was bankrupt at the time with Cinderella, seemingly, about to be the last animated feature to come out, because of this Cinderella's staff, especially animators, were low-budget. Eventually the honor of Cinderella's Дизайн (influenced by Mary Blair's artwork) was bestowed upon Marc Davis with Eric Larson and Les Clark as supervising animators.

Walt Дисней had chosen Marc Davis specifically, because Mary Blair's art suggested softer lines and Davis was someone he new was very good with making soft characters, mostly do to his Назад creations like Bambi and Katrina фургон, ван Tassel. In fact, around the studio he mostly animated Животные and Золушка was his секунда time animating a human character (with Alice, Aurora and Динь-Динь soon to come).

Marc Davis was very fond of the "simple country girl" aspect for her design, but he wanted aspects of her to be beautiful to "really offset the ugliness of the step-sisters."
In many early concepts of Золушка she has hardly any features in attempt to match the Mary Blair art style, but eventually she started gaining еще detailed features with Davis favoring the sketches in which she had two plats on each side of her head.





Of course the live-action reference model had a lot to do with how Cinderella's hair and outfits eventually turned out, in fact Дисней himself liked the model's style and Актёрское искусство for reference and wanted her image nearly copied; However Davis didn't much care for her structure and designed Золушка by her voice actor instead of the model.
